Comprehending the Role of a Conservatory Contractor

A conservatory contractor is a customized professional responsible for designing, planning, and constructing conservatories. Their tasks include examining the property, supplying design options, obtaining essential permits, and managing the total construction procedure. A reputable contractor will ensure that the job fulfills both visual and functional requirements while adhering to local guidelines and building regulations.

Key Responsibilities of a Conservatory Contractor

DutyDescription
Design ConsultationCollaborates with homeowners to produce custom designs that match their preferences and the existing architecture of the home.
Allowing and Legal IssuesBrowses local building guidelines, using for licenses and ensuring compliance with zoning laws and safety standards.
Material SelectionEncourages on the best products for construction, balancing visual appeals, toughness, and cost.
Project ManagementManages the whole construction process, coordinating with subcontractors, managing timelines, and guaranteeing quality workmanship.
Post-Construction SupportProvides aftercare services, consisting of service warranty info and upkeep guidelines for the completed conservatory.

Qualities of a Trusted Conservatory Contractor

To discover a credible conservatory contractor, homeowners must think about a number of vital qualities. These attributes can substantially impact the general success of the project.

1. Experience and Expertise

A contractor with extensive experience in building conservatories brings important insights and abilities. Homeowners should try to find specialists who have been in the industry for numerous years and have a portfolio of completed jobs that showcase their work.

2. Credibility and Reviews

A dependable contractor will have a favorable track record in the community. Prospective clients can check online reviews, request referrals, and look for suggestions from friends or household. A contractor with a performance history of satisfying customers is more most likely to provide quality outcomes.

3. Clear Communication

Effective communication throughout the task is important. An excellent contractor listens to the property owner's concepts, offers updates, and addresses concerns promptly. Clear understanding assists prevent misconceptions and makes sure that the job continues efficiently.

4. Openness in Pricing

Trusted contractors supply in-depth price quotes that break down costs, including materials, labor, and any extra charges. This openness helps homeowners budget effectively and prevent unforeseen costs down the line.

5. Quality Assurance

A reputable contractor will guarantee the quality of their work, providing warranties on both materials and labor. This guarantee supplies house owners with assurance, understanding that they are covered in case problems arise after the job's completion.

Actions to Choose the Right Conservatory Contractor

Picking the ideal conservatory contractor can feel overwhelming, however following these steps can simplify the procedure:

Step 1: Research and Compile a List

Start by investigating local conservatory professionals. Compile a list of possible candidates, taking note of their specialties and past projects.

Step 2: Check Credentials

Verify that the contractors are licensed and guaranteed. Appropriate licenses show that they meet industry requirements, and insurance coverage protects homeowners from liability in case of mishaps throughout construction.

Step 3: Request Quotes

Connect to the selected specialists and demand in-depth quotes. Compare the propositions based upon expense, materials, timelines, and services consisted of.

Step 4: Ask Questions

Schedule conferences with the professionals to discuss your job. Ask about their experience, previous jobs, and how they manage unanticipated problems throughout construction.

Step 5: Review Contracts Thoroughly

Before signing any contract, examine the contract thoroughly. Guarantee it consists of all agreed-upon terms, such as payment schedules, timelines, and warranties.

Action 6: Make Your Decision

After examining all elements, consisting of experience, prices, and individual connection, make a well-informed decision on which contractor to work with.

2. What types of conservatories are offered?

Conservatories are available in several designs, consisting of Victorian, Edwardian, Lean-to, and Gable-fronted. Each style has its special functions and benefits.

3. Do I require planning permission for a conservatory?

In a lot of cases, conservatories fall under allowed advancement rights, implying planning permission is not required. Nevertheless, this can vary by place, so it's necessary to inspect local guidelines.

4. Just how much does a conservatory expense?

The expense of a conservatory can vary extensively based on elements such as size, products, and design. Property owners can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 30,000 or more.

5. What is the best way to keep a conservatory?

Regular cleaning, looking for leakages, and making sure the seals and frames are in great condition are necessary upkeep steps. House owners ought to likewise check the roofing routinely for particles and damage.
